Mainstream science long ignored laughter and even today many questions about the origins function and mechanisms of laughter remain unanswered. What is it that triggers laughter in the brains of primates medical science suggests that there is no Single Center in the brain responsible for laughter not activates a number of different regions including the brain stem and some more evolved areas of the brain. Laughter is not simply a reflex its a complex neural activity. Laughter is a mystery that scientists are still working to decode. These scientists on mavericks pioneers they even then.
